Celebrating synergy and youth in DC's art world, TRANSFORMER and CORCORAN are pairing up for two companion shows this month, celebrating the work of Corcoran alumni who have helped shape 10 years of TRANSFORMER's exhibit seasons:
- transformers, which will be presented at the Corcoran's Gallery 31 (and photos of which you can find below) features new works by artists: Reuben Bresslar, Breck Brunson, Jessica Cebra, Natalie W. Cheung, Cynthia Connolly, Jennifer De Palma, Nilay Lawson, Hatnim Lee, Marissa Long, Maki Maruyama, Solomon Sanchez, Mica Scalin, Zach Storm, Tang, and Jason Zimmerman.
- transformers: the next generation, which opens at Transformer's 14th & P Street, NW project space on September 17, features new works by five recent graduates of the Corcoran College of Art + Design's class of 2011: Forest Allread, Pavlos Karalis, Sarah Robbins, Aris Slater, and Victoria Shaheen.
